🔍 Lesson 01: How to Find a Seller on Alibaba
Let’s open our laptops and visit Alibaba.com. Think of it like a huge global shopping center, but for wholesale buyers and businesspeople.
Here’s what you do:
Create an Alibaba account. It’s free — like signing up for a new library card.
In the search bar, type “soft toys” or “plush toys.”
You’ll see a huge list of suppliers — don’t panic! We’ll narrow it down together.
Use these filters:
Trade Assurance: Protects your payment.
Verified Supplier: Means Alibaba has checked them.
Low MOQ: Look for suppliers that offer small minimum orders (like 10 or 50 pieces).
Check their profile:
Years of experience
Customer ratings and reviews
Product photos and descriptions
Whether they provide samples
💬 Lesson 02: How to Contact the Seller
Okay, let’s say you found a cute teddy bear listing. Now it’s time to contact the supplier. But please — don’t write messages like “price pls.”
Here’s a proper way to ask:
Hello, I’m interested in your 12-inch plush teddy bears. Could you share the MOQ, sample cost, and shipping price to Sri Lanka? Also, do you offer customized packaging or logo printing?
See? Clear, respectful, and professional.
Tip: Stay on Alibaba chat until you feel confident. Avoid going to WhatsApp too soon that’s like walking into a new neighborhood without a guide.
🚢 Lesson 03: Understanding Shipping Methods
Now let’s say you’re happy with the sample and ready to place an order. But how do these toys reach your hands?
There are two common ways:
Seller-Arranged Shipping: They do everything and ship directly to your address. This is called “door-to-door.”
Your Own Shipping Agent: You hire someone to collect the goods from the factory and send them to you. This might save money, especially for larger orders.
📄 Lesson 04: What Documents You’ll Need
This sounds complicated, but it’s not. Think of it like your school admission — paperwork is needed, but it’s manageable.
Common import documents:
Commercial Invoice: Shows item details and price
Packing List: What’s in the box
Bill of Lading / Air Waybill: For shipping tracking
Import Permit (if needed in Sri Lanka)
Your shipping agent or supplier will help you collect these.

⚠️ Mistakes to Avoid
| Mistake | Solution |
|---|---|
| Low quality products | Always order a sample first |
| Shipping delays | Confirm delivery timelines |
| Miscommunication | Be clear and polite |
| No demand | Test your market early |
🧮 Final Task: Build Your Mini Business Plan
Let’s imagine:
100 soft toys ordered
Product cost: $250
Shipping and fees: $150
Total investment: $400 (~Rs. 124,000)
Sale revenue: Rs. 195,000
Profit: Rs. 71,000 🎉
